The Importance Of Paramedic Science With Foundation Year

Paramedic science is a vital field that plays a crucial role in our healthcare system. Paramedics are highly trained professionals who provide emergency medical care to individuals in critical situations. They are often the first responders at the scene of an accident or medical emergency, making split-second decisions that can mean the difference between life and death. In order to become a paramedic, individuals must undergo rigorous training and education, culminating in a degree in paramedic science.

One option for individuals interested in pursuing a career in paramedic science is to enroll in a program that includes a foundation year. The foundation year provides students with the necessary knowledge and skills to succeed in the demanding paramedic science program. In this article, we will explore the importance of paramedic science with foundation year and how it can benefit aspiring paramedics.

Paramedic science is a multifaceted field that requires a solid understanding of anatomy, physiology, pharmacology, and emergency medical procedures. The foundation year allows students to build a strong academic foundation in these areas before diving into the more specialized coursework of the paramedic science program. This ensures that students are well-prepared for the challenges they will face as paramedics and have a solid understanding of the medical concepts that underpin their practice.

In addition to academic preparation, the foundation year also helps students develop essential skills such as communication, problem-solving, and critical thinking. These skills are essential for successful paramedics, who must be able to work effectively under pressure, communicate clearly with patients and colleagues, and make quick decisions in high-stress situations. The foundation year provides students with the opportunity to hone these skills and prepare themselves for the demands of a career in paramedic science.

Another key benefit of paramedic science with foundation year is that it provides students with a smooth transition into the paramedic science program. The foundation year helps students acclimate to the academic rigor and pace of the program, giving them a head start on their coursework and allowing them to hit the ground running when they officially begin their paramedic science studies. This can be especially helpful for students who may have been out of school for a while or who are transitioning from a different field of study.

paramedic science with foundation year also opens up opportunities for students who may not meet the traditional entry requirements for a paramedic science program. The foundation year provides a pathway for students to build the necessary academic skills and knowledge to succeed in the program, even if they do not have a background in science or healthcare. This can help diversify the paramedic workforce and ensure that individuals from a wide range of backgrounds have the opportunity to pursue a career in paramedic science.
